Tattoos are more than just visual art; they are a form of personal expression that often carries profound meanings. When combined, clock and flower motifs in tattoos create a rich tapestry of symbolism. Clocks, with their relentless tick-tock, symbolize the inexorable march of time, reminding us of the fleeting nature of life and the importance of making every moment count.

On the other hand, flowers represent the beauty and fragility of life. They are a testament to nature's resilience and the cyclical nature of existence, with their blooms and fades mirroring the birth, growth, and transformation of all living things. Together, these elements in a tattoo design create a powerful statement about the beauty of transience and the importance of embracing every stage of life.

The choice of flower species and clock design can further enhance the tattoo's symbolism. For instance, a delicate cherry blossom paired with a vintage pocket watch might symbolize the fleeting beauty of youth, while a vibrant rose and a modern, minimalist clock could represent the resilience and timelessness of love. The interpretation is as unique as the individual, making these tattoos deeply personal and meaningful.

The versatility of clock and flower tattoo designs allows for an endless array of creative interpretations. Here are some popular design variations and their unique characteristics:

Vintage Elegance

A popular choice for clock and flower tattoos is the vintage style. These designs often feature intricate details, inspired by antique pocket watches or grandfather clocks. The flowers in these tattoos are usually delicate and romantic, such as roses, lilies, or peonies. The overall effect is one of timeless elegance, with the clock’s intricate gears and hands enhancing the flower’s ethereal beauty.

Modern Minimalism

For those who prefer a more contemporary look, modern minimalist clock and flower tattoos offer a sleek and stylish alternative. These designs often feature clean lines, simple clock faces, and a limited color palette. The flowers in these tattoos are usually bold and graphic, such as bold sunflowers or modern interpretations of wildflowers. The focus is on simplicity and impact, making a powerful statement with minimal details.

Nature’s Whimsical Fusion

Some tattoo artists take a more imaginative approach, blending the clock and flower motifs in a whimsical fusion of nature and time. These designs might feature flowers growing out of clock faces, clock hands intertwining with flower petals, or even a clock tower with a vibrant floral garden in place of its traditional face. The result is a unique, dreamlike scene that captivates the eye and sparks the imagination.

Clock and flower tattoos offer a range of technical challenges and opportunities for tattoo artists. The intricate details of clock mechanisms and the delicate petals of flowers require precise line work and shading techniques. Artists must master the balance between intricate details and overall composition, ensuring that the tattoo is both aesthetically pleasing and technically sound.

The choice of tattoo ink colors can also significantly impact the final result. Vibrant, bold colors can bring a modern, energetic feel to the tattoo, while softer, muted tones can create a more romantic and vintage atmosphere. The size and placement of the tattoo also play a crucial role, with larger pieces allowing for more intricate details and smaller tattoos requiring a more minimalist approach.

What is the significance of clock and flower tattoos?

+

Clock and flower tattoos symbolize the passage of time and the beauty of nature. They remind us of the fleeting nature of life and the importance of embracing every moment.

Are clock and flower tattoos only for women?

+

Absolutely not! While these tattoos often feature delicate floral elements, they can be designed to suit any gender. The symbolism and aesthetics of clock and flower tattoos make them a popular choice for both men and women.

How long does it take to get a clock and flower tattoo?

+

The time it takes to complete a clock and flower tattoo can vary widely, depending on the size, complexity, and skill of the artist. Smaller, simpler designs may take a few hours, while larger, more intricate pieces could require multiple sessions spanning several days or even weeks.
